Observations of structure, phase and composition on unidirectional solidified Y-Ba-Cu-O samples
1994
We have performed the unidirectional solidification in the Y–Ba–Cu–O system and successfully produced textured YBa2Cu3O7-δ samples with Y2BaCuO5 precipitates. The addition of Y2BaCuO5 to YBa2Cu3O7-δ at the start of the process plays an important role in achieving continuous textured growth because it prevents a liquid change in composition. We found a segregation of matrix at the bottom region of the sample after solidification. In this paper, we report the observations of structure, phase and composition on unidirectionally solidified Y–Ba–Cu–O samples.
